Output 53cd283e5fd708db0c0095d01a3da65b44a86ab85d4da2ad64184b609bc73727:12

value
41589373
script pubkey
OP_0 OP_PUSHBYTES_20 8db8630dfc657a999b494247403561ae0e98183a
address
bc1q3kuxxr0uv4afnx6fgfr5qdtp4c8fsxp649rxx0
transaction
53cd283e5fd708db0c0095d01a3da65b44a86ab85d4da2ad64184b609bc73727
spent
true